Product Description:
The CSH01.1C-PL-ENS-ENS-EN2-NN-S-NN-FW is a control section produced by Bosch Rexroth Indramat for the CSH Advanced Controllers series. Installed in modular drive racks, it processes motion commands in real time. It also converts field-level feedback and issues switching signals that synchronize servomotor axes with PLC sequences in industrial automation cells.
This module draws a base power of 7.5 W, which represents its internal logic demand before any I/O loading is added. Each digital input changes state once the line reaches 15 V, ensuring noise immunity on field wiring. Digital outputs can source up to 500 mA, allowing direct actuation of low-power contactors or indicator lamps. The card has sixteen channels in each direction in a 16 In / 16 Out parallel configuration, so discrete devices can be wired without extra expansion boards. Form-C relay contacts are rated at 24 VDC, 1 A; this electromechanical path is used when galvanic isolation from the drive backplane is required for external interlocks. An analog DAC furnishes 5 V at 1 mA for proportional valve or reference signal tasks, and RS-232 communication is supported over cables up to 15 m with a selectable pulse width ceiling of 100 ms for event timing.
During power-up the controller withstands an inrush current of 4 A, so supply sizing must accommodate this brief surge. Serial diagnostics stream at up to 115 kBaud, enabling parameter backups without slowing the machine cycle. The ENS encoder interface operates from an 11.6 V supply with 120 Ω input resistance and 500 mA current capability, suiting long differential runs. The second encoder channel (EN2) is powered from a 5.0 V rail, delivers 350 mA, and tolerates 35 Ω load resistance, making it suitable for TTL-level feedback. These limits help protect the controller from overstress in multi-axis drive installations.
